Research on ultra precision Mirror Machining Technology for Aluminum Alloy Mobile Phone Shell

  In this paper,the ultra-precision mirror polishing technology was adopted for mirror processing experimental study of Aluminum Alloy mobile phone shell.The experiments show that:polishing pressure,Grinding disc speed,the texture and hardness of polishing pad and abrasive particle size are the main factors to affect the surface quality.Through to optimize these parameters matching combination,can effectively improve the surface quality and reduce the surface roughness and obtain surface roughness is Ra0.026μm.
